Mega Man 10 - Solar Man

Description


An attempt at a Super Smash Bros.-inspired recreation of the Robot Master, Solar Man, from Mega Man 10.

He comes with a somewhat-hokey Solar Flare both in its balled up form (which comes with a ready-made rotating loop) and its explosive wave form.

Included are sequences which open his hands wider, clench his fists or point his index fingers. I also gave him some eyelids with sliders for blinking, an angry face or a sad face. Additionally, I added two bones on both his shoulders which should hopefully alleviate any major clipping that occurs when you rotate his arms.

It took a long old time to make this model, this being my first attempt at high-poly baking in Blender and texture-painting in any sort of detail. Everything was made from scratch, using the Wii U model of Mega Man as a reference.

If there are any issues with the model, please let me know.
